Assam Chief Minister Sarbananda Sonowal on Monday distributed one-time financial assistance of Rs. 50,000 to 1,000 sportspersons who brought laurels to the state at various national and international events.
Sonowal also handed over sports pension to former sportspersons of the state, along with one-time financial assistance at a programme held in Guwahati.
The State NSS Award for the year 2018-19 was also distributed during the programme.
Besides this, CM Sonowal along with Union Minister Rameswar Teli inaugurated the renovated Bimala Prasad Chaliha Swimming Pool at TRP Indoor Stadium.
“Giving a major boost to the swimming scenario of Assam, CM Shri @sarbanandsonwal along with Union Min Shri @Rameswar_Teli & Min Shri @SBhttachrya inaugurated the renovated Bimala Prasad Chaliha Swimming Pool at TRP Indoor Stadium, Guwahati,” CM Sonowal Tweeted.
With an aim to provide medical support to journalists in the state, the Chief Minister inaugurated a medical center of Assam Sports Journalists Association at TRP Indoor Stadium in Guwahati.
